Services and Charities we support

RAPHAEL’S LIFE HOUSE
www.raphaelslifehouse.org  (RLH),
a Covenant House NJ www.covenanthousenj.org  program in Elizabeth, is a safe-haven for homeless, pregnant women and their babies, once born. RLH provides a safe and supportive living environment within which these mothers are offered services to help them develop the skills and values needed for responsible parenthood. All women between the ages of 18 and 23 are welcome regardless of race, creed, color, national origin, or economic status. RLH’s goal is to give these women the tools needed to establish an independent living situation for themselves and their families. To learn more about Raphael's Life House, please call 973-286-3400.

About the Ministry
The Blessed Expectations Ministry is a group of volunteers committed to empowering women and their children by improving the quality of their day-to-day lives. We believe this can be achieved in various ways including, but not limited to, creating a safe, nurturing, and comfortable environment in which to develop and grow. This is why Blessed Expectations is assisting with the transformation of the living space at Raphael's Life House. Your donations and our hard work will make this possible.
